The group AHOF has presented a powerful performance of their new song 'Pinocchio Hates Lies,' satisfying the fans' five senses.

On SBS's 'Inkigayo,' which aired on the 23rd, AHOF (Steven, Seo Jung-woo, Cha Woong-ki, Zhang Shuai-bo, Park Han, JL, Park Ju-won, Z EON, Daisuke) performed the title track from their second mini-album 'The Passage.'

From the start, AHOF commanded the stage with dynamic choreography that captured attention and unwavering live vocals. The members flawlessly executed powerful singing and performances in sync with the song's intense progression, delivering a thrilling sensation to the audience.

Notably, the signature choreography, which intuitively conveyed the song's message, induced strong addiction. For the lyrics 'Just hug me once,' they performed a gesture reminiscent of an embrace, and for the line 'Pinocchio hates lies,' they showcased a witty move depicting Pinocchio's growing nose, leaving an unforgettable impression on the fans.

'Pinocchio Hates Lies' is a song with band sounds inspired by the fairy tale 'Pinocchio,' capturing the sincere hearts of the AHOF members who wish to be honest only with 'you,' despite their anxieties.
